Lee Mount - w/e 26th July

 It's been a good week again for butterflies in the garden. Unprecedented in the continuing hot, sunny days, mainly attracted to Verbena bonariensis as well as Buddleia, Echinacea and White Valerian etc...

1 Painted Lady, 2 Gatekeeper, 6+Small White, 2+Large White, 1 Red Admiral, 1 Peacock, 1 Small Copper, 1 Holly Blue (daily), 1 Peacock. 1 Comma, 1 Small Skipper, 3+ Meadow Brown, 1 Speckled Wood and just 1 Green-veined White.

Also yesterday morning a Purple Hairstreak turned up fluttering on the grass in the early morning sunshine, I suspect it was attracted to morning dew (?). I have seen this with them in recent years.
It was a surprise as I've not seen them over the nearby oaks at all yet this year.
I grabbed some shots but camera was on the wrong setting and they are just about bleached out though can just see enough detail to confirm its identity.

One nice moth this morning despite the overnight rain.

Lee Mount (recently)

 

Pebble Prominent - 23 July
Only the second one I've had here. The first was a dead one from a spiders web on 21st July 2024.

Engrailed - 21st to 23rd July
A first for here - a really nice moth. This one stayed three days on the fence by the light trap.

Box-tree Moth -  23rd July
A species origin in China and Korea first seen in the UK in 2007 and then in 2014 in Yorkshire. The larva are a pest of Box hedges.
